Etymology of RUTH FULTON

The name "Ruth Fulton" does not have its own specific etymology, as it is a combination of two separate names. "Ruth" is a Hebrew name meaning "compassionate" or "friend". "Fulton" is a surname of Scottish origin, derived from a place name meaning "foul town" or "muddy town". Therefore, the etymology of the individual names would be Hebrew and Scottish, respectively. However, when used together as a full name, "Ruth Fulton" does not have a distinct etymology as it is simply a combination of these two names.
